    Pearce Butcher is a Landscape Designer. She specializes in residential projects, collaborating with homeowners to help them find thoughtful and innovative designs for their outdoor environments. No two of her designs are the same; she works carefully with each client to ensure their space is used to its fullest capacity. She has worked with noted HGTV hosts in her native U.S., been featured in different publications, and created designs for several high-end residential clients.

    Yes, this course is designed for beginners with no prior experience in landscape design or fine art. You'll learn foundational concepts and practical skills step-by-step.

    You'll need basic drafting tools such as vellum, a T-square, architectural scale ruler, circle templates, markers, and a tape measure. Most items are affordable and easy to find at art or office supply stores.

    You’ll learn how to apply art principles outdoors, draft site plans by hand, analyze client needs, select and organize plants, create balanced compositions, and use both traditional and digital techniques for landscape design.

    No, the course introduces drawing and drafting techniques from the basics, making it accessible to those without previous art or design experience.

    The course guides you through site analysis, client interviews, drafting base plans, and applying design principles to create functional and beautiful residential gardens tailored to user needs.

    Yes, you'll study how to select and combine plants for color, texture, and form, and use these elements to create visually engaging and harmonious outdoor spaces.

    Yes, the course covers how to use plant shapes, textures, and groupings as artistic elements to enhance garden design and create focal points.
